Ghana Blind Union To Benefit From Maiden Edition Of Japan Motors/E.Tv 5km Corporate Run

Accra, September 6, 2011: The Ghana Blind Union (formerly the Ghana Association of the Blind) will soon be beneficiaries of financial support, thanks to the collaborative efforts of Japan Motors and e.tv Ghana. This September 17th, Japan Motors in conjunction with e.tv Ghana have joined heads to organize a 5km Corporate Run that is aimed at bringing different corporate institutions in Ghana together as an innovative approach to networking through a team-building physical activity. The proceeds from the event will be donated to support the Ghana Blind Union.

The two companies are collaborating to provide a unique platform to all corporate bodies to network and interact with their colleagues from other fields in a way that has never been done before.

According to Hilda Peasah, Marketing Manager at Japan Motors states, “The aim of the event is to facilitate growth within the various business communities, by introducing a different and innovative approach to networking and showcasing new products in the market. Whatever we get from this event will be used to support the Ghana Blind Union (formerly Ghana Association of the Blind).”

General Manager of e.tv Ghana, John Osei Tutu Agyeman, added that “sports and physical activities is a universal language that brings people together no matter their background or origin. The 5km Corporate Run will be beneficial to businesses and individual participants. They will get the opportunity to network with fellow corporate giants in different business sectors and also get a chance to preview what’s new on the market. E.tv Ghana is serious about contributing its quota to a healthy nation; we are even more thrilled that that we will be donating the proceeds from the event to support our visually-impaired brothers and sisters.”

According to the organizers, registration is open to all corporate institutions and individuals interested in participating in the run. Companies and individuals can register for free at Pippa’s Health Centres, Japan Motors, e.tv Ghana, Silver Star Tower (Airport City), Koala Supermarket and the Silverbird Lifestyle Store. Categories to be awarded include fastest woman, fastest man, fastest over 40, fastest over 50 and fastest corporate team (first corporate team to have five people finish).

Following the award ceremony, there will be an exhibition which will highlight what’s new in Accra and give sponsors the opportunity to showcase their new products, creating a platform for them to incorporate what’s new in the market into the networking experience.
